Finding Restaurants That Deliver to Your Hotel

One of the first steps in ordering pizza to your hotel room is finding a restaurant that delivers to your location. This can be done by searching online or checking with the hotel staff for recommendations. Many hotels have partnerships with local restaurants and can provide you with a list of options that deliver to their location. You can also check websites like Grubhub, UberEats, or DoorDash to see which restaurants in your area offer delivery to hotels.

When searching for restaurants that deliver to your hotel, be sure to read reviews and check the menu to ensure that they offer the types of food you’re in the mood for. You should also check the restaurant’s delivery area to make sure that your hotel is within their boundaries. Some restaurants may have specific requirements or restrictions for delivering to hotels, such as a minimum order amount or a specific delivery time, so be sure to ask about these when placing your order.

In addition to searching online, you can also ask the hotel staff for recommendations on restaurants that deliver to their location. They may have a list of preferred vendors or partners that they work with, and can provide you with more information on the types of food they offer and their delivery policies. This can be a great way to get a more personalized recommendation and ensure that you’re getting the best possible service.

Tipping Your Delivery Driver

When it comes to tipping your delivery driver, it’s always a good idea to show your appreciation for their hard work and service. The standard tip for a delivery driver is 10-15% of the total order, but you can adjust this based on the quality of service and the distance they had to travel.

For example, let’s say you’re staying at a hotel in Los Angeles and you order a pizza from a local restaurant. The total cost of the order is $20, and you want to tip the delivery driver 15% for their service. You can calculate the tip by multiplying the total cost by 0.15, which would be $3. You can then add this to the total cost of the order, for a total of $23.

When tipping your delivery driver, be sure to consider the quality of service they provided and the distance they had to travel. If the driver was friendly and courteous, and the order was delivered quickly and efficiently, you may want to consider tipping on the higher end of the scale. On the other hand, if the driver was unfriendly or the order was delayed, you may want to consider tipping on the lower end of the scale.

What if I have a food allergy or dietary restriction?

If you have a food allergy or dietary restriction, be sure to inform the restaurant when placing your order. Many restaurants have options that are gluten-free, vegan, or vegetarian, and they may be able to accommodate your needs. You can also ask about the ingredients used in their menu items and whether they can modify anything to suit your dietary needs.

For example, let’s say you’re staying at a hotel in New York City and you have a gluten intolerance. You can ask the restaurant about their gluten-free options and whether they can modify any of their menu items to accommodate your needs. They may be able to offer a gluten-free crust or substitute gluten-free ingredients in their sauces and toppings.

In addition to informing the restaurant about your food allergy or dietary restriction, you should also ask about their cross-contamination procedures and whether they can prepare your food in a dedicated gluten-free or allergen-friendly environment.
